PLEASE NOTE THAT THE MINUTE REQUIRES TO BE APPROVEDAS A CORRECT RECORD AT THE NEXT COUNCIL MEETINGAND MAY BE AMENDEDEAST AYRSHIRE COUNCILLOCAL REVIEW BODYMINUTES OF MEETING HELD ON MONDAY 18 FEBRUARY 2013 AT 1133HOURS IN THE COUNCIL CHAMBERS, COUNCIL HEADQUARTERS, LONDONROAD, KILMARNOCKPRESENT: Councillors Jim Ro<strong>be</strong>rts, Andrew Hershaw, George Mair, Bobby McDilland David Shaw.ATTENDING: Karl Doroszenko, Development Planning and Regeneration Manager;Melanie Barbour, Solici<strong>to</strong>r; and Jennifer Morrison, Administrative Officer.CHAIR: Councillor Jim Ro<strong>be</strong>rts, Chair.APPLICATION NO 13/0002/LRB: CLONHERB FARM, STEWARTON (PLANNINGAPPLICATION NO 12/0519/PP) (Item 3, Page , 12/17)1. Following an accompanied site visit attended by Councillors Jim Ro<strong>be</strong>rts, AndrewHershaw, George Mair, Bobby McDill and David Shaw <strong>to</strong>ge<strong>the</strong>r with Craig Ilesrepresenting <strong>the</strong> Head of Planning and Economic Development, Amy Townsend andAndrew Mair, <strong>the</strong> applicant’s representatives, Jim Smith representing <strong>the</strong> Head ofRoads and Transportation Division, Bill Gilchrist representing Environmental HealthServices, Karl Doroszenko, Development Planning and Regeneration Manageracting <strong>as</strong> Planning Adviser and Jennifer Morrison, Administrative Officer, held prior<str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ong> meeting, Mem<strong>be</strong>rs considered <strong>the</strong> application for erection of one wind turbineup <strong>to</strong> a maximum tip height of 61m and ancillary infr<strong>as</strong>tructure for a temporary periodof 25 years at Clonherb Farm, Stewar<strong>to</strong>n.The updated position statement, <strong>the</strong> Notice of Review submission, <strong>the</strong>representations received in relation <str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ong> original planning application, andsuggested planning conditions were all circulated.The Local Review Body considered <strong>the</strong> Notice of Review submission dated 18Decem<strong>be</strong>r 2012 and o<strong>the</strong>r supporting documents <strong>as</strong> well <strong>as</strong> <strong>the</strong> originalrepresentations from interested parties. A supporting statement which w<strong>as</strong>submitted <strong>as</strong> part of <strong>the</strong> Notice of Review and location plans/pho<strong>to</strong>montages weremade available (a) on <strong>the</strong> Councillors’ Portal; (b) on <strong>the</strong> Council website; and (c) at<strong>the</strong> Local Review Body meeting.The Local Review Body taking account of <strong>the</strong> materials produced, agreed <strong>that</strong> it hadsufficient information <strong>be</strong>fore it and <strong>that</strong> <strong>the</strong> review application could <strong>be</strong> determinedwithout fur<strong>the</strong>r procedure in terms of <strong>the</strong> Town and Country Planning (Schemes ofDelegation) and Local Review Body Procedure (Scotland) Regulations 2008.The Local Review Body determined in its view <strong>the</strong> proposed development w<strong>as</strong>acceptable and <strong>as</strong> a consequence <strong>the</strong>refore determined <strong>that</strong> <strong>the</strong> application <strong>be</strong><strong>approved</strong> subject <str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ong> suggested planning conditions <strong>as</strong> detailed in Appendix 3 of<strong>the</strong> position statement and subject also, <str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ong> conclusion of a Section 75 Agreement


2for <strong>the</strong> purpose of (1) ensuring <strong>the</strong> provision of a Res<strong>to</strong>ration Bond by <strong>the</strong> Applicantfor all decommissioning and site res<strong>to</strong>ration costs on <strong>the</strong> expiry of <strong>the</strong> PermissionPeriod or such o<strong>the</strong>r earlier date should <strong>the</strong> wind turbine <strong>be</strong> removed prior <str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ong>expiry of <strong>the</strong> Permission Period; and (2) reviewing <strong>the</strong> adequacy of <strong>the</strong> Res<strong>to</strong>rationBond during <strong>the</strong> duration of <strong>the</strong> planning permission.The meeting terminated at 1153 hours.
